Why Is Your Evaporative Cooler Blowing Hot Air: Causes and Solutions

Why Is Evaporative Cooler Blowing Hot Air
Evaporative coolers, also known as swamp coolers, are an energy-efficient and cost-effective way to keep your home cool during hot weather. They work by drawing warm air through water-saturated pads, where the air is cooled through the process of evaporation before being circulated into your living space. Understanding How Evaporative Coolers Work
Before we delve into the causes of hot air blowing from your evaporative cooler, let’s briefly understand how these devices work when they’re functioning correctly. Evaporative coolers operate on a simple principle: they use the natural process of water evaporation to cool the surrounding air. Here’s how it works:
A water pump circulates water from a reservoir to wet pads or cooling media.
A fan draws warm air from the outside through these wet pads.
As the warm air passes through the damp pads, it loses heat through the evaporation process.
The now-cooler air is blown into your living space, providing a refreshing cooling effect.

Insufficient Water Supply
One of the most common reasons for an evaporative cooler blowing hot air is an insufficient water supply. If the water pump isn’t delivering enough water to saturate the cooling pads, the cooling effect will be compromised, resulting in hot air being blown into your home.
Solution: Check the water supply to the cooler. Ensure the water level in the reservoir is adequate and that the water pump is functioning correctly. Clean or replace any clogged filters or water lines that may be obstructing the water flow.
Dirty or Clogged Cooling Pads
Over time, the cooling pads in your evaporative cooler can become dirty or clogged with dust, minerals, and debris. This can impede the airflow and reduce the cooling efficiency of the cooler, leading to hot air output.
Solution: Regularly clean or replace the cooling pads as recommended by the manufacturer. Cleaning the pads will ensure better water evaporation and cooling performance.
Inadequate Ventilation
For an evaporative cooler to work effectively, it requires proper ventilation to expel hot air from your living space. If the room is not adequately ventilated, the cooler may struggle to cool the air, resulting in hot air being circulated.
Solution: Ensure there is sufficient cross-ventilation in the room. Open windows and doors to allow the hot air to escape, creating a natural flow of cooler air from the evaporative cooler.
High Humidity Levels

Solution: Consider using your evaporative cooler in conjunction with a dehumidifier to reduce indoor humidity levels. This will enhance the cooling performance of the evaporative cooler in humid conditions.
Mechanical Issues
Mechanical problems with the fan, motor, or water pump can also cause your evaporative cooler to blow hot air. If any of these components are malfunctioning, it can disrupt the cooling process.
Solution: Inspect the fan, motor, and water pump for any signs of damage or wear. Replace or repair any faulty components to ensure the cooler operates efficiently.
